Comparative study of the relaxation mechanisms of the excited states of cytosine and isocytosine
Authors:Rumyana I. Bakalska  Vassil B. Delchev
Affiliation:1. Faculty of Chemistry, University of Plovdiv, Tzar Assen 24 Str., 4000, Plovdiv, Bulgaria
Abstract:An experimental and theoretical investigation was performed to study the photostability of cytosine and isocytosine. The experimental UV irradiation of acetonitrile solutions of the two compounds showed that the amino-oxo tautomer of cytosine is photostable while the amino-oxo tautomer of isocytosine tautomerizes to the amino-hydroxy form. The theoretical investigations were carried out at the CC2 level of theory. They were performed to explain the experimental observations. It was found that the 1ππ* excited states of the ring deformation mechanisms of cytosine and isocytosine relax (internal conversion) to the ground states of the amino-oxo forms of the compounds. We propose a channel for the radiationless deactivation of the repulsive 1πσ* excited state of the amino-oxo form of isocytosine to the ground state of the amino-hydroxy tautomer.
